La versione 2019 di Visual Studio soffre di un noiosissimo bug che rende le finestre Model explorer e Mapping details del designer di Entity Framework 6 completamente nere o addirittura trasparenti. Ripristinare o disinstallare e reinstallare Visual Studio 2019 non sortisce alcun effetto in quanto il vero problema risiede nel come Visual Studio gestisce il multimonitor con monitor che hanno DPI differenti (come spesso capita quando si lavora con un laptop e un monitor fisso).
In attesa di un fix ufficiale, che sebbene il bug sia stato identificato da tempo non è ancora stato rilasciato, possiamo aggirare il problema andando nel menu Tools -> Options e nella finestra delle opzioni selezionare a sinistra Environment -> General e infine deselezionare il checkbox "optimize rendering for screens with different pixel densities". Una volta riavviato Visual Studio, le finestre del designer appariranno normalmente.
Commenti
Per inserire un commento, devi avere un account.
Fai il login e torna a questa pagina, oppure registrati alla nostra community.
Approfondimenti
Raggruppamento degli aggiornamenti di dipendenze tra directory in un monorepo con Dependabot
Modificare lo stile in una QuickGrid Blazor
Supporto nativo a JSON in SQL Server 2025
Rendere affidabile lo scale out su Azure App Service
Azure SQL Database per dev: tutte le novità da non perdere
Configuratione e utilizzo .NET Aspire CLI
Analizzare il contenuto di una issue con GitHub Models e AI
Impostare automaticamente l'altezza del font tramite CSS
Importare un servizio esterno in .NET Aspire
Utilizzare noopener e noreferrer nei link HTML
Integrare il Docker Model Runner in un workflow di GitHub
Utilizzare le direttive più importanti in una file based app .NET


